

17th January 2023
Front End Developer
Location: Dundee or Newcastle
Urban Foresight is the UK’s leading place-based innovation consultancy. We work with ambitious clients around the world on strategies and solutions for smart and sustainable cities.
We’re looking for a talented developer to take a leading role in creating bespoke digital tools and web applications.
These tools will extend, enhance, and automate our consultancy services. They will also provide solutions to external clients to improve the delivery of public services and infrastructure.
Current projects include a site selection tool for electric vehicle charging infrastructure, and a data catalogue for local government APIs.
The role
You’ll apply your impressive front-end skills to develop and deliver solutions for a variety of projects. This will involve close working with our consultancy teams to design, develop, and maintain new digital tools and websites.
We value individuals with a real passion for solving problems. We’re especially interested to meet people who can balance deep technical knowledge with the ability to deliver practical solutions.
You should apply if you’re:
- An experienced front-end developer
- Excited about being involved in innovative projects that improve lives and protect the environment
- Motivated to take a leading role in a growing business
- Enjoy sharing your knowledge and working with passionate people.
Responsibilities:
- Converting design visuals into fully responsive front-end code.
- Writing and maintaining clean, efficient, and well documented codebases.
- Providing specialist knowledge to optimise performance and accessibility.
- Predicting and planning your work and coordinating efforts with other team members
Required experience:
- Front-end programming skills, such as modern JavaScript, HTML, CSS
- Front-end frameworks, such as React or Angular
- Data visualisation, and mapping
- Operating content management systems such as WordPress
- Working with cloud solutions, including Amazon Web Services
- Version control software, such as git
- UX / UI design
- Diagnostic accuracy and problem-solving for debugging websites
Preferred:
- Familiarity with a wide variety of development frameworks
- Interested in innovation, sustainability, and the wider work of our business
- Good time management habits, ability to multi-task, and ability to sustain focus on long tasks
- Good communication and interpersonal skills
- Proven ability to deliver results with intermittent supervision
- Agile enough to jump into projects and be comfortable in exploring multiple possibilities before landing on a specific solution
How to apply
Applications should be made in the form of a full CV and covering statement sent to people@urbanforesight.org .
Please indicate in your covering statement why you want the job, your salary expectations, preferred location, and notice period.
Urban Foresight strives to be an equal opportunities employer and welcomes applications from all suitably qualified persons.